Tcl/Tk for Programmers: With Solved Exercises that Work with Unix and Windows

Zimmer Zimmer

  • 出版商: IEEE
  • 出版日期: 1998-09-10
  • 售價: $4,270
  • 貴賓價: 9.5$4,057
  • 語言: 英文
  • 頁數: 564
  • 裝訂: Paperback
  • ISBN: 0818685158
  • ISBN-13: 9780818685156
  • 相關分類: 程式語言
  • 海外代購書籍(需單獨結帳)

買這商品的人也買了...

商品描述

Description:

This introduction to Tcl/Tk bridges the gaps between introductions, comprehensive manuals, and collections of scripts that solve particular problems. There are over 200 exercises with solutions for both Unix and Windows platforms.

Tcl/Tk for Programmers introduces high-level Tcl/Tk scripting language to experienced programmers with either Unix or Windows backgrounds. It includes a short introduction to TCP/IP, introductions on writing client-side scripts and GUI interfaces as well as integrating scripts with C/C++. In addition to covering version 8.0/8.0, the book describes the major differences between version 8.0/8.0, 7.6/4.2, and the experimental alpha version 8.1/8.1. Zimmer has extensive knowledge of Tcl/Tk programming and currently runs a consulting and training company based on his experience.

 

 

Table of Contents:

Forward.

Acknowledgements.

1. Getting Started.

I: Tcl.

2. Basic Syntax and I/O.

3. Expressions and Branching.

4. Procedures.

5. Data Structures and Iteration.

6. Strings, Files, and Glob Pattern Matching.

7. Regexp and Regsub.

8. Tcl Odds and Ends.

9. More about Procedures.

10. TCP/IP Networks and Event-Driven Programming.

II: Tk.

11. Overview of Tk.

12. Widget Characteristics.

13. Geometry Management.

14. Some Basic Widget Types.

15. List of Widget Types.

16. Bindings. 17. Partially Displayed Widgets.

18. Text Widgets.

19. Canvases.

20. Tk Odds and Ends.

21. The Browser Plugin and Safe-Tcl.

III: C/C++.

22. The C/C++ Connection.

23. Essential Library Functions.

24. Some Useful Library Functions.

25. Creating Tcl Objects in C/C++.

Bibliography.

Index.

商品描述(中文翻譯)

描述:
這本介紹 Tcl/Tk 的書籍填補了介紹、全面手冊和解決特定問題的腳本集之間的差距。書中提供了超過200個練習題和解答,適用於Unix和Windows平台。
《Tcl/Tk for Programmers》向具有Unix或Windows背景的有經驗的程式設計師介紹了高級的Tcl/Tk腳本語言。書中包括了簡短的TCP/IP介紹,以及撰寫客戶端腳本和GUI界面以及將腳本與C/C++集成的介紹。除了涵蓋8.0/8.0版本外,本書還描述了8.0/8.0版本、7.6/4.2版本和實驗性的alpha版本8.1/8.1之間的主要差異。Zimmer對Tcl/Tk編程有豐富的知識,目前根據他的經驗運營著一家咨詢和培訓公司。

目錄:
前言。
致謝。
1. 入門。
I:Tcl。
2. 基本語法和輸入/輸出。
3. 運算和分支。
4. 函數。
5. 數據結構和迭代。
6. 字符串、文件和Glob模式匹配。
7. 正則表達式和Regsub。
8. Tcl的其他功能。
9. 有關函數的更多內容。
10. TCP/IP網絡和事件驅動編程。
II:Tk。
11. Tk概述。
12. 小部件特性。
13. 幾何管理。
14. 一些基本小部件類型。
15. 小部件類型列表。
16. 綁定。17. 部分顯示的小部件。
18. 文本小部件。
19. 畫布。
20. Tk的其他功能。
21. 瀏覽器插件和Safe-Tcl。
III:C/C++。
22. C/C++連接。
23. 基本庫函數。
24. 一些有用的庫函數。
25. 在C/C++中創建Tcl對象。
參考文獻。
索引。